/*html{font-size:100.01%;height:100%} */
body{
font-size:8pt;
font-family:tahoma,arial,verdana;
color:#000000;
margin:0;
padding:0;
text-align:center;
background:#fff !important;
line-height:1.4;
}
a img, img{margin:0;padding:0;border:0;}
a{color:#262626;outline:none;}
a:hover{color:#ff9900;}
p,h1,h2,h3,h4,h5,h6,ul,ol,li,form,table,td{margin:0;padding:0;}
table{font-size:1em;}
.clear{clear:both;}
.fl{float:left;}
.fr{float:right;}
hr,.noScreen{display:none;}
.break{display:block;}
fieldset{padding:0;margin:0;border:0}
ul li{list-style-type:none;}
ol li{list-style-type:decimal;}
.clearfix:after{content: ".";display:block;height:0;clear:both;visibility:hidden;}
.clearfix{display:inline-block;}
/* Hide from IE-mac \*/
* html .clearfix{height:1%;}
.clearfix{display:block;}
/* End hide from IE-mac */
.imgBlock{
position:relative;
display:block;
overflow:hidden;
}
.imgSpan{
position:absolute;
left:0;
top:0;
display:block;
background-position:top left;
background-repeat:no-repeat;
}
a .imgSpan{
cursor:pointer;
}
.rel{
position:relative;
}
#page{
width:618px;
margin:0px auto;
text-align:left;
position:relative;
}
#header{
width:618px;
height:140px;
position:relative;
}
#header h2{
position:absolute;
top:43px;
left:0;
}
#headerAbout{
width:300px;
position:absolute;
top:36px;
right:0;
background-color:#e6e6e6;
font-size:10px !important;
}
#headerAbout .headerAboutCol{
width:120px;
_width:140px;
float:left;
padding:10px 0;
}
p.headerAboutCol{
width:100px !important;
margin:0 40px 0 10px;
display:inline;
}
#content{
width:618px;
}
.leftCol{
width:300px;
float:left;
}
.rightCol{
width:300px;
float:right;
}
h1{
font-size:14px;
font-weight:bold;
padding:0 0 10px;
}
h3{
font-size:12px;
font-weight:bold;
padding:0 0 8px;
}
.box460{
width:276px;
_width:298px;
padding:11px;
/*background:url(../images/cs/print-nemov/box-460-bg.gif) repeat-y;*/
border:1px solid #cdcdcd;
position:relative;
margin:0 0 20px;
}
.box460Top{
width:298px;
height:9px;
display:none;
position:absolute;
top:0;
left:0;
background:url(../images/cs/print-nemov/box-460-top.gif) no-repeat;

}
.box460Bot{
width:298px;
height:9px;
display:none;
position:absolute;
bottom:0;
_bottom:-10px;
left:0;
background:url(../images/cs/print-nemov/box-460-bot.gif) no-repeat;
}

img#maklerImg{
float:left;
margin:0 11px 0 0;
border:1px solid #cdcdcd;
width:80px;
display:none;
}
#maklerText{
float:left;
width:260px;
}
#maklerText h2{
font-size:14px;
font-weight:bold;
padding:0 0 8px;
}
#maklerText h3{
font-size:12px;
font-weight:bold;
padding:0;
}
#maklerText a:hover{
color:#ff9900;
}
#maklerText p{
padding:0 0 10px;
}
#maklerText p.small{
font-size:11px !important;
}
#maklerLangs{
font-size:11px;
}
#maklerLangs li{
padding:0 0 2px 20px;
position:relative;
}
#maklerLangs li a{
margin-left:10px;
}
#maklerLangs li.en{
background:url(../images/cs/flag-en.gif) no-repeat 0 3px;
}
#maklerLangs li.de{
background:url(../images/cs/flag-de.gif) no-repeat 0 3px;
}

#nemPhotosImg{
margin:0 0 20px;
position:relative;
}
#nemPhotosImg img{
float:left;
_margin:0 -3px;
border:10px solid #e6e6e6;
width:278px;
height:auto;
}
#nemPhotosImg span{
width:258px;
_width:278px;
height:24px;
_height:31px;
padding:7px 10px 0;
filter:alpha(opacity=75);
-moz-opacity:0.75;
opacity:0.75;
background-color:#000;
display:block;
position:absolute;
bottom:10px;
_bottom:9px;
left:10px;
color:#fff;
text-decoration:none;
}

table.nemInfo{
width:100%;
}
table.nemInfo thead th,table.nemInfo thead td{
text-align:left;
vertical-align:top;
padding:0 12px 3px 0;
border-top:0;
}
table.nemInfo tbody th,table.nemInfo tbody td{
text-align:left;
vertical-align:top;
padding:3px 12px 3px 0;
border-top:1px solid #cdcdcd;
}
.boxMap{
width:280px;
_width:300px;
height:208px;
_height:228px;
padding:0px;
border:10px solid #e6e6e6;
margin:0 0 20px;
}
#boxMapIn{
width:280px;
height:248px;
}
#boxMapIn img{
width:280px;
}

